Good day:

I found a mysterious folder on my C drive today. It is named e461501210837d39f20438efb4 and contains a folder named "download". In turn, this folder contains a file named dao360.dll._p .
I scanned it with Wormguard that called it "suspicious" because of the double extension. I scanned it with TDS-3 with no reaction. I scanned it with Panda AV ( completely updated) and no viruses found. Pest Patrol found nothing wrong with it.

Is it possible that this is some debris left over from a recent Microsoft Explorer update?

Should I send it in anyway ?
